When Daisy found out she had given birth to a girl she said "I hope she'll be a fool-that's the best thing a girl can be in this world, a beautiful little fool."

When daisy gets asked about her daughter what does she say in the great gastby?

In "The Great Gatsby," Daisy refers to her daughter as "a lovely little fool." This remark reflects Daisy's superficial nature and her lack of genuine connection with her daughter. Daisy's comment also highlights her disillusionment with the world around her and her tendency to prioritize appearances over substance.
